A tragic incident occurred in Gwaram Local Government Area of Jigawa State, where a 20-year-old man, Muhammad Salisu, allegedly murdered his biological father, Salisu Abubakar.
The attack reportedly took place on the night of Monday, May 5, 2025, in Bakin Kasuwa Quarters, Sara District.
According to a local resident, the family woke up to find the 52-year-old victim covered in blood with multiple machete wounds across his body.
He was rushed to the Federal Medical Center (FMC) in Birnin Kudu, where a medical doctor confirmed him dead.
Spokesperson of the Jigawa State Police Command, SP Lawan Shiisu Adam, confirmed the incident in a statement.
He said preliminary investigations revealed that Muhammad attacked his father with a machete, inflicting severe injuries to the neck, chest, and shoulder.
Police officers from the Sara Division responded swiftly to the scene, arrested the suspect, and recovered the weapon used in the attack.
The Commissioner of Police in Jigawa, CP AT Abdullahi, has directed that the case be transferred to the State Criminal Investigation Department in Dutse for further investigation.
The suspect is expected to be charged to court upon the conclusion of the investigation.
